Output e3bf6d5fbbcc22ba7a7c63f0801df7130d86cba6a10bbc8996ce82fd0a5b46bc:0

value
410498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b8a863e02fa8c18ab1f40518b0d266a90264e3 OP_EQUAL
address
3Ehf62jfDTp6HRjLkf6taTAc6pWagw5ZLu
transaction
e3bf6d5fbbcc22ba7a7c63f0801df7130d86cba6a10bbc8996ce82fd0a5b46bc
confirmations
235171
spent
true